Output 91ec3c5245efbc5c7a55ef2017f52c3e85ff4eba67928198faf4dcd92bc4fd39:1

value
537322940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6be4b20cd6634bb733706b237a7437e404593a OP_EQUAL
address
MDKMMJsicFmuEX238PCbxcNsH4xd6cmwYf
transaction
91ec3c5245efbc5c7a55ef2017f52c3e85ff4eba67928198faf4dcd92bc4fd39
spent
true